Lifts for Bearsted Station's New Bridge

- sign now
Goal reached ! 108 / 100

It is unbelievable to me that the new bridge could have been installed without being DDA-compliant. I have spoken to the station master, and lifts are available as a bolt-on addition, "if there is sufficient demand."

As things currently stand, anyone in a wheelchair has to go on to Ashford and then back again to Bearsted. Buggy pushers at least have rest spaces on the new brdige.
